W3C中国

W3C发布CSS伪元素模块、CSS排除模块的标准工作草案

2015年1月15日,W3C的CSS工作组发布了两份标准工作草案:

- CSS伪元素模块(CSS Pseudo-Elements Module Level 4):这是该文档的首份公开工作草案,定义了伪元素(pseudo-elements),它是对CSS渲染树中的一个局部子树所对应的可选择的元素的抽象。

- CSS排除模块(CSS Exclusions Module Level 1):工作草案。该模块定义了一个任意区域,内容可以绕着这个定义的区域流式布局。CSS Exclusions可以在任何CSS block-level元素基础上定义,它扩展了之前内容环绕的标记。

CSS是描述结构化文本(如HTML、XML等)在屏幕、纸张、语音上如何绘制和展现的语言。更多信息,请参阅W3C的样式标准计划(Style Activity)。   

 

W3C发布拼接与混合(Compositing and Blending)的候选推荐标准

2015年1月13日,W3C的CSS工作组可扩展矢量图(SVG)工作组联合发布了拼接与混合(Compositing and Blending Level 1)的候选推荐标准(Candidate Recommendation),向公众征集参考实现。

这里的拼接是指如何将不同元素所对应的显示区域(shapes)拼接成一个单一的图像。有多种可能的方式实现这种内容拼接。之前版本的可扩展矢量图(SVG)采用简单的Alpha Compositing方法。在这个模型中,每个元素被渲染到各自的缓冲区中,然后使用Porter-Duff模型中的Source-Over混合方式合成为一幅图像。该标准草案将扩展简单Appha Compositing模型,并支持更多的Porter Duff混合方式,高级的混合模型(blending modes)也定义了当不同显示区域重叠时如何控制颜色的混合。此外,该规范还定义了用于混合和组隔离(group isolation)的CSS属性,以及在HTML Canvas 2D Context(Level 2)中定义的'globalcompositeoperation'属性。

更多信息,请参阅本文的英文原文,及W3C的样式标准计划(Style Activity)图形标准计划(Graph Activity)。 

W3C与W3Ctech社区在北京联合举办首届CSS开发者大会

css-dev.jpg2014年11月21日消息:为了响应广大开发者对深入了解CSS技术的要求,W3C将于2015年1月10日与W3Ctech社区在北京航空航天大学新主楼会议中心第一报告厅联合主办首届CSS开发者大会。期待您的参与!

W3C CSS工作组负责人Bert Bos先生将为本次活动做主题发言,为开发者介绍W3C CSS工作组近期的主要工作进展,以及对未来CSS标准技术的展望。同时,大会还邀请到了贺师俊(新浪微博 @johnhax),程劭非(新浪微博 @寒冬winter)以及薛丽丽(新浪微博 @点头猪)等社区著名CSS技术专家到场与大家分享。因会场座位有限,报名请从速。

本届大会得到了upyunGitCafe懒投资车牛云适配七牛100offerGoogleUCloudBroadview图灵教育teambitionsegmentfault等企业的支持和赞助。更多信息,请参阅本届大会主页。 

附:日程安排 (地点:北航新主楼会议中心第一报告厅)

8:30 签到

9:30 会议开幕及来宾致辞

9:40 Bert Bos(W3C): CSS的未来

10:40 休息

11:00 winter/程劭非(阿里巴巴):重识CSS

12:20 午餐

13:30 johnhax/贺师俊(百姓网):“CSS框架”的迷思

14:40 点头猪/薛丽丽(携程):移动时代CSS对用户体验的影响

15:20 休息及合影

15:50 灭灭/侯迈(豆瓣阅读):豆瓣阅读在 WebFont 上的探索和实践

16:15 jaychsu/苏峻弘(GitCafe):Flexbox,更优雅的布局

16:40 尤雨溪(Meteor):CSS 与界面动效

17:10 一丝/李杰(阿里妈妈):CSS工作流

17:40 勾三股四/赵锦江(阿里巴巴):Web Components中的CSS

17:55 吴小倩(W3C/北航):谈谈CSS性能

18:30 大会结束 

W3C启动新一期JavaScript, 响应式Web设计, HTML5在线培训课程

2014年12月23日,W3C宣布将在2015年初启动新一期JavaScript, 响应式Web设计, HTML5在线培训课程。这是W3C在线课程计划 W3DevCampus的一部分。本期课程包括:

- JavaScript:该课程从2015年1月26日开始,为期4周。提供关于JavaScript相关的最佳实践、经验和工具使用,并提供了丰富的案例和作业。欢迎在线注册

- HTML5:该课程从2015年2月2日开始,为期6周。课程内容覆盖视频、基于时序的动画设计、2D几何变换、Web音频API、Web组件模型(web components)等。欢迎在线注册

- 响应式Web设计(Responsive Web Design):该课程从2015年2月6日开始,为期5周。课程将引导您一步步学习如何基于HTML和CSS进行响应式Web设计,让你的Web应用适应不同的屏幕尺寸(viewport size)。欢迎在线注册

提早注册上述课程均可获得注册费率优惠。更多信息,请参阅英文原文,及W3C面向Web开发者的在线培训课程(W3DevCampus)。欢迎查看关于Web在线培训的有趣视频。 

 

 

W3C发布CSS行内布局模块及盒式对齐模块的标准工作草案

2014年12月18日,W3C的CSS工作组发布了两份标准工作草案:

- CSS行内布局模块(CSS Inline Layout Module Level 3):这是该规范的首份公开标准工作草案。CSS的格式模型(formatting model)允许容器内的一组元素及其内部文本流按行现实(wrapped into lines)。在一行中的元素及文本的格式(如行的书写方向及在行中的位置、断行规则等)可以由CSS文本模块(CSS Text Module Level 3)表达。本模块描述了元素和文本在行中的位置。这个位置也通常和行的基线(baseline)相关。该模块也描述了与首行(first line)及首字母大写(drop caps)相关的格式特性。本模块基于CSS 2.1扩展。

- CSS盒式对齐模块(CSS Box Alignment Module Level 3):这是该规范的工作草案。该模块主要描述在各种不同的CSS盒式布局模型(如块布局/block layout,表布局/table layout,弹性布局/flex layout及网格布局/grid layout)下,容器内多个盒(box)位置对齐相关的CSS特性。

CSS是描述结构化文本(如HTML、XML等)在屏幕、纸张、语音上如何绘制和展现的语言。更多信息,请参阅英文原文,及W3C的样式标准计划(Style Activity)。   

 

W3C发布印度文字布局需求的首份工作草案

2014年12月16日,W3C国际化兴趣组(Internationalization Interest Group)印度文字布局特别任务组(Indic Layout Task Force)发布了印度文字布局需求(Indic Layout Requirements)的首份公开工作草案。该文档描述了印度文字布局及显示时的基本需求,讨论了印度语言文字中的首字母伪元素(first letter pseudo-element)、字符的竖排版(vetical arrangements of characters)、字母间距、文字对齐(text segmentation)、分行(line breaking)及排序规则(collation rule)等与语言及文化有关的需求。这份文档中提到的布局与排版需求也同样适用于电子出版及CSS标准。

该文档覆盖了印度语言文字内容呈现的主要需求,也提供了基于扩展巴克斯范式ABNF(Augmented Backus-Naur Form)的描述。这有助于定义标准化的印度语言文字布局格式,帮助浏览器正确的理解并显示印度语言文字,并推动印度语言文字在Web及各种数字媒体上符合文化习惯的存储、渲染和呈现。

更多内容,请参阅英文原文,及W3C的国际化标准计划(Internationalization Activity)。W3C中国目前正在推进中文文字布局需求(Chinese Layout Requirements)的工作,此前,W3C已发布了日文韩文拉丁文字的布局排版需求。

W3C发布几何接口模块的候选推荐标准 征集参考实现

2014年11月25日,W3C的CSS工作组SVG工作组共同发布了几何接口模块(Geometry Interfaces Module Level 1)的候选推荐标准(Candidate Recommendation),向公众征集参考实现。该规范提供了一组基本的几何接口,用来表示点、矩形等基本几何元素,以及用于几何变换的变换矩阵(transformation matrix),这些接口可以被其他规范或CSS模块所使用。W3C在2014年6月9月曾发布该规范的标准工作草案

更多信息,请参阅英文原文,及W3C的样式标准计划(Style Activity),及图形标准计划(Graphics Activity)。 

W3C发布滤镜效果(Filter Effects)模块的标准工作草案

2014年11月25日,W3C的级联样式单(CSS)工作组可扩展矢量图(SVG)工作组联合发布了滤镜效果模块(Filter Effects Module Level 1)的标准工作草案。滤镜效果是在文档显示时对元素进行渲染的处理方式。通常,通过CSS或SVG渲染一个元素的过程如下:元素首先被绘制到一个图像绘制缓冲区中,然后将缓冲区的图像合并到父节点中。滤镜效果可以在缓冲区图像被合并前对图像内容进行处理(如锐化、改变颜色的饱和度等)。尽管滤镜效果最初设计用于SVG图像的处理,但它也可适用于其他的表现环境(如CSS等)。滤镜效果由filter属性中的样式指令触发。该规范允许通过HTML或SVG中使用CSS指定内容的样式来触发滤镜效果,定义了CSS的属性、值及其对应的处理过程。W3C在2013年11月发布过该标准草案的较早前版本

更多信息,请参阅英文原文,及W3C的样式标准计划(Style Activity)图形标准计划(Graphics Activity)。 

W3C技术大会及顾问委员会会议(TPAC 2014)在圣克拉拉举行

tpac20142014年11月2日消息,W3C年度技术大会及顾问委员会会议(W3C Technical Planery and Advisory Committee Meeting,TPAC 2014)于2014年10月27-31日,在美国加州圣克拉拉(Santa Clare)举行。本届大会由W3C/MIT承办,共有超过550人注册参会。中国方面,来自中国联通、中国移动、百度、华为、腾讯、上海鸿窗、北航、浙江大学、Intel(上海研发中心)等会员单位,及中兴通讯、旺达等非会员单位受邀代表共30余人参加了此次会议。

在为期五天的会议中,共有HTML, CSS等36个工作组在TPAC期间举行了工作组会议。10月28日,W3C宣布发布HTML5的正式推荐标准,这成为今年会议的最大亮点。10月29日技术日(plenary day)上午和中午共举行28个向公众开放的分论坛研讨,覆盖未来Web基础、运营商参与、Web支付、Web安全等热门话题。10月28、30日两天,有200多名会议代表参加了W3C的顾问委员会会议。10月29日下午还举行了有800人参加的Web未来研讨会暨W3C 20周年纪念(W3C 20)活动,与会嘉宾分享了未来Web的期望,该活动对TPAC注册用户和公众开放。 

在本届TPAC会上,百度之前提出的关于首屏渲染优化的提案在Web性能工作组(Web Performance WG)及HTML工作组会议上进行了充分的讨论,所提出的需求得到了与会者的广泛关注和认可;在9月11日中文版式需求标准研讨会上提出的中文字体及呈现需求提案由W3C中国和国际化(i18n)工作组联合提出并在CSS工作组、国际化工作组会议上进行了讨论;关于设立中文(含少数民族语言)版式特别任务组(Chinese Layout Task Force)的建议在国际化工作组、数字出版标准计划(Digital Publishing Activity)的工作会议上进行了讨论,并获得通过。此外,在 Web未来研讨会暨W3C 20周年纪念(W3C 20)活动上,百度代表还向与会专家展示了Baidu Eye、百度快搜等创新产品和技术。我们感谢所有中国会员在这些工作上的支持和不懈努力!

TPAC是W3C的年度重要技术会议之一,仅对W3C会员和特邀专家开放。其中,会议第三天的技术日(Plenary Day)将向公众开放,分组讨论与W3C未来技术相关的话题。参会者将共同协调未来开放Web平台的技术方向,讨论W3C的组织策略。TPAC期间将举行各个工作组会议(Working Group Meetings)、顾问委员会会议(Advisory Committee Meeting)等会议。TPAC 2015将于2015年10月在日本札幌举行,由W3C/Keio承办。

更多内容,请参阅Jeff Jaffe的博客文章:W3C Blog: A Productive TPAC 2014 and W3C Highlights。 

W3C发布7份与CSS相关的工作组备忘 中止相关标准工作

2014年10月14日,W3C的CSS工作组发布了7份工作组备忘。CSS工作组将不再继续开展这些工作。

- CSS TV Profile 1.0。该文档定义了一个CSS 2的子集,以及一个CSS 3的模块,描述与电视设备相关的颜色标准。

- CSS展示等级模块(CSS Presentation Levels Module)。该文档定义了一种用作演讲幻灯显示时对内容进行分级,超过某一等级的内容将被以不同方式进行样式处理及显示。另一个用例是显示文档的不同目录级别。

- CSS Mobile Profile 2.0。该文档定义了一个CSS 2.1的子集,作为在受限资源设备(如手机等移动设备)上实现CSS互操作性的一个基线。它试图在设备能力不满足CSS总体规范要求时,定义一个至少应被满足的特性子集,并与OMA Wireless CSS 1.1/1.2保持一致。

- CSS字幕模块(Marquee Module Level 3)。该文档定义了与字幕效果相关的CSS特性。相关工作已转至TTML工作组。

- CSS的行为扩展(Behavioral Extensions to CSS)。该工作组备忘向每个元素绑定一个“behavior"属性,该属性通过一个URL,指向一个用XBL等标记语言描述的用户交互行为。 

- CSS3超链接展示模块(Hyperlink Presentation Module)。该文档用于定义页面在渲染超链接时的不同效果。

- CSS 'Reader' 媒体类型 (CSS 'Reader' Media Type)。该文档定义了一种称为“reader"的媒体类型,用于指示能够支持语音合成和显示文字同步的一类样式单。

更多信息,请参阅英文原文,及W3C的样式标准计划(Style Activity)

W3C HTML中文兴趣小组技术分享: CSS Will Change规范介绍

2014年10月13日消息,W3C HTML中文兴趣组于2014年10月13日(星期一)晚9:00-10:00 进行了第五轮在线技术分享。本次分享由W3C HTML中文兴趣小组的赵锦江主持,主题是《CSS Will Change规范介绍》,技术视频可以通过视频(土豆)直接观看。欢迎关注并在22日晚9点QQ技术分享群(88268721)交流。

CSS Will Change Module Level 1是CSS工作组发布的优化页面渲染的标准草案,辉希完成了该规范的中文志愿者翻译版本,供参考。

这是HTML5中文兴趣小组系列技术分享的第五期,前三期活动主题分别是ECMAScript 6规范导读CSS Counter StylesService Worker标准解读、Web Components介绍等,相关音视频及演讲材料已上线。欢迎感兴趣的同学可加入技术分享QQ群88268721。

W3C HTML中文兴趣小组是W3C HTML标准计划的一部分,其宗旨在于以中文(简体或繁体)协调与讨论HTML5规范以及与之相关的其他W3C规范,收集这些规范的评论、问题及在中文环境下的特殊应用场景和测试用例。该兴趣组也在组织系列W3C标准及文档的志愿者翻译工作,并积极推进中文(汉语)文字布局及排版需求等工作。HTML中文兴趣小组对公众开放。

W3C发布CSS区域模块(CSS Regions Module Level 1)的标准工作草案

2014年10月9日,W3C的CSS工作组发布了CSS区域模块(CSS Region Module Level 1)的标准工作草案。该标准允许来自一个或多个元素的内容流填充到一个或多个盒(Box)区域,这些区域被称为CSS Region,并按照CSS3-BREAK的要求进行断行分块。该模块也定义了CSSOM暴露一个fragmentation的输入和输出。W3C在2014年2月曾发布该标准的工作草案。

CSS是描述结构化文本(如HTML、XML等)在屏幕、纸张、语音上如何绘制和展现的语言。更多信息,请参阅英文原文,及W3C的样式标准计划(Style Activity)。 

站内搜索

万维网联盟(World Wide Web Consortium, W3C)是Web领域的国际标准化组织,致力开发开放Web标准确保Web的长期发展,实现“尽展Web无限潜能”的使命。

更多内容>>

近期活动

更多内容>>

W3Cx 开放课程

W3C技术标准

查看Web技术标准
- 所有标准
■ Web与产业融合 ■
- 汽车 | 数字出版 | Web与电信
- 娱乐与广播电视 | Web支付 | Web数据
- 物联万维网(WoT) | Web安全
■ Web For All ■
- Web无障碍 | 国际化 | 索引(A to Z)
■ 社区组与商务组 ■
- 所有社区组 | 新建社区组
■ 标准工作组 ■
- 所有标准小组 | 参与指南

更多内容>>

W3C标准翻译

欢迎您加入W3C翻译计划,了解W3C标准和文档翻译情况,帮助提供不同语言的W3C标准规范及文档的志愿者翻译及W3C授权翻译,惠及全球技术社区。

更多内容>>

贡献榜

我们通过贡献榜,感谢您积极参与W3C的标准制定及审阅工作、提供标准及技术文章的中文翻译、参与各类技术研讨会。

更多内容>>

W3C 中文开发者社区

W3C中国目前正在不断加大全球W3C工作的参与力度,并推动了一系列以了解中国行业需求、引导标准制定为主要目的的工作组(WG)、兴趣组(IG)和社区组(CG)。
Web中文兴趣组 | MiniApps工作组 | MiniApps生态社区组 | 弹幕特别任务组 | 中国信息无障碍社区组 | 中文数字出版社区组 | 数据可视化社区组 | 中文文字布局需求特别任务组

更多内容>>

会员链接

相关资源需要使用 W3C账号登录后使用

首页 | 加入工作组 | 申请W3C账号 | 最新会员消息

开发者资源

合作伙伴

  • 北京航空航天大学
  • 北航计算机学院
  • w3ctech